Abbe Ranch House

Designated: February 3, 2004
Location: Larkspur
Current Owner: Private Property
Nominated By: Richard A. Farmer

Historic Significance

The Abbe Ranch House was the only home of the James and Polly Abbe family.  James Abbe was a well-known photographer, having photographed many stars of the silent screen.  He also covered the Spanish Civil War from 1936 to 1937, opposite Ernest Hemmingway. He was the first Western photographer to photograph Stalin.

The children, Patience, Richard and John, wrote three books and were famous in their own right.  The Abbes purchased the land and constructed the home with the proceeds of the children’s books.  The children were the actual owners of the home. The ranch house was completed in 1938.
